Output 3ab10568b58967d5f296c2b532289593e2a53b0fb5bb7917b42412e4994c928d:0

value
993471
script pubkey
OP_0 OP_PUSHBYTES_20 94b29e93e30307c1ea2643fcf832e6d708d9ce59
address
bc1qjjefaylrqvrur63xg070svhx6uydnnjerpyq2n
transaction
3ab10568b58967d5f296c2b532289593e2a53b0fb5bb7917b42412e4994c928d
confirmations
172366
spent
true